Increase Drift Point multiplier for Driftzones so players can beat there Series 1 Pbs again

Since Series 2 Update the drift community basically shrink down by 90% due to the devs reducing smth in the alogrithm for driftpoints so you get about 20% less driftpoints in ALL Driftzones… For some players (me included) hunting down personal bests in driftzones was the most fun thing in the game. But now my and others motivation to play the game active is very low. Please PGG increase the driftzone points by 20-23% so everyone will be able to beat there scores in Driftzones again and play the game more active. shouldnt be too hard lets be real

The decrease is is by approx (1275000/1560000)x. This decrease is so large, it is impossible to get close to your old Personal Bests if your skill level doesnt change from before compared to after the update

5 Likes

Before the update my cara este pb was 1.51 million or so and now it is 1.26 million

SO i thought 20-23% was a good idea since they removed that the holes in the road doesnt give points. now they do

What if they had 2 sets of leaderboards for everything. An all time leaderboard (current) which never resets, as well as a new seasonal leaderboard which resets every 4 months.

The new seasonal leaderboard would become the default view whereas the all time leaderboard would require a button press or scroll to view.

When the seasonal leaderboard resets you’re awarded a badge and accolade based on your place on each leaderboard. You can also view your pbs from previous seasons. These never go away.

That way no matter what changes, bugs or cheats happen in a season it will only effect the all time leaderboard which evidently they will never reset.
